Pole-zero plot and frequency response from a transfer function 1

Draw the pole-zero plot and graph the frequency response for the system whose transfer function is

\mathrm{H}(z)={\frac{z^{2}-0.96z+0.9028}{z^{2}-1.56z+0.8109}}.

Step-by-Step
The 'Blue Check Mark' means that this solution was answered by an expert.
Learn more on how do we answer questions.

The transfer function can be factored into

\mathrm{H}(z)={\frac{(z-0.48+j0.82)(z-0.48-j0.82)}{(z-0.78+j0.45)(z-0.78-j0.45)}}.

The pole-zero diagram is in Figure 9.16.

The magnitude and phase frequency responses of the system are illustrated in Figure 9.17
